Notes
A Canadian band called Bobby And Synthia were the support act.
Canadian music channel Much Music interviewed Martin and Dave on this day. Canadian music channel Musimax broadcast the performances of New Life and Just Can't Get Enough. New Life appears to have been edited shorter for broadcast.
